Unique French-Canadian-Congolese trio with pianist Benoît Delbecq, bassist Miles Perkin and percussionist Emilie Bayiendan tours eight cities in Finland.
A distinguished French pianist Benoît Delbecq brings his top-notch ensemble Benoît Delbecq 3 to Finland in April for Vapaat äänet tour. The group has earlier been warmly welcomed by the Finnish audience and on this tour they will perform their new music and music from the vaunted album Ink, released in 2014. In addition to Delbecq the ensemble is formed by Canadian bassist Miles Perkin and Congolese percussionist Emilie Bayienda. The tour starts from Loviisa on 13th of April.
Trio plays distinctive modern jazz combining rhythmic innovation with strong composing and the result grows hypnotic in places. The atmosphere is described as “sweet dizziness” by the pianist himself and with the African beat it comes close to musical trance.
